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-42934

Self registration does not use site language setting

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Won't Fix
    • Affects Version/s: 2.4.7, 2.5
    • Fix Version/s: None
    • Component/s: Authentication
    • Labels:
    • Testing Instructions:
      Hide
      1. Visit <yoursite>/admin/tool/langimport/index.php and install a new language pack.
      2. Visit <yoursite>/admin/settings.php?section=langsettings and set the 'Default language' to the one you installed.
      3. Visit <yoursite>/admin/settings.php?section=manageauths and set 'Self registration' to 'Email-based self-registration'.
      4. Register as a new user on your site.
      5. Log in using that user and check their profile and ensure the 'Preferred language' is set to the site wide setting.
      Show
      Visit <yoursite>/admin/tool/langimport/index.php and install a new language pack. Visit <yoursite>/admin/settings.php?section=langsettings and set the 'Default language' to the one you installed. Visit <yoursite>/admin/settings.php?section=manageauths and set 'Self registration' to 'Email-based self-registration'. Register as a new user on your site. Log in using that user and check their profile and ensure the 'Preferred language' is set to the site wide setting.
    • Affected Branches:
      MOODLE_24_STABLE, MOODLE_25_STABLE
    • Pull Master Branch:
      MDL-42934_master
    • Story Points:
      5
    • Sprint:
      BACKEND Sprint 7

      Description

      1. Visit <yoursite>/admin/tool/langimport/index.php and install a new language pack.
      2. Visit <yoursite>/admin/settings.php?section=langsettings and set the 'Default language' to the one you installed.
      3. Visit <yoursite>/admin/settings.php?section=manageauths and set 'Self registration' to 'Email-based self-registration'.
      4. Register as a new user on your site.
      5. Log in using that user and notice that the user setting 'lang' is set to 'English' (which is the database default), rather than the site language setting.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              markn Mark Nelson
              Reporter:
              markn Mark Nelson
              Peer reviewer:
              Petr Skoda
              Participants:
              Component watchers:
              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: